    Abstract: Provided are an analytic method to provide information needed for the diagnosis of patients with ovarian cancer resistant to paclitaxel which is an anticancer drug widely used in the treatment of ovarian cancer, the method comprising a step of measuring the expression level of a gene encoding at least one deubiquitinating enzyme selected from the group consisting of USP3, USP9X, USP26, USP34, COPS5, OTUD6A, and OTUD7A, in a tumor cell sample externally discharged from an ovarian cancer patient; and a kit for diagnosing ovarian cancer resistant to paclitaxel, the kit comprising a molecule capable of measuring the expression level of a gene encoding the protein.

    Abstract: An electric stimulator for alpha-wave derivation is characterized in that frequency selected from a range of 1 Hz to 50 Hz, preferably, 7 Hz to 14 Hz, and an output voltage are applied to auricle of a patient's ears to derive alpha-waves, and that cycle and intensity of stimulation are varied depending upon body temperature and blood sugar. Prompt reaction may be obtained by directly applying the voltage to the ears, and the reaction may continue when stimulation is extended. In addition, it is suitable to treat various diseases having common cause due to stress or arousal reaction in the human body.
